Doug Khazzam and Alan Milman continued on after the breakup of the original Buddy Love (Joey Kelly, Scott Schiller, Rich Stirrat and of course Doug) and reformed the band this time with Doug taking over lead vocals and "becoming" Buddy Love. Enlisting bandmates from their punk rock days (Brett Rizzo on bass and Rob Wise on drums) they recorded this PowerPop tour de force (as described by many fans of the genre at the time). Even though this record became semi-legendary at the time and influential to other DIY bands of the 1980's, it somehow remained relatively unknown! Very Highly Recommended!
